Throughout human history, mind-altering substances have played a profound, often controversial role in shaping culture, spirituality, and societal structures. From the mysterious Kykeon of ancient Greek rituals to the sacred mushrooms of Mesoamerica, natural psychedelics have long been used to induce visions, facilitate divine communication, and foster deep communal bonds. However, while these substances were revered as sacred tools in many ancient civilizations, they eventually became the target of intense fear, leading to some of the darkest chapters in history, including the infamous European and American witch hunts.

In ancient times, shamans, high priests, and medicine women held high status for their ability to navigate altered states of consciousness. They utilized plants and fungi, such as ergot, belladonna, and psilocybin, to heal the sick and connect with the spiritual realm. These rituals were seen as essential for the well-being of the community. However, as organized religious and political hierarchies sought to consolidate power during the medieval period, these traditional practices were demonized. The ecstatic visions and herbal knowledge once deemed divine were suddenly rebranded as heresy and witchcraft.

Historians now suggest that many accusations of witchcraft were directly tied to the accidental or intentional consumption of psychotropic plants. Ergot poisoning, a fungus that grows on rye and causes vivid hallucinations, muscle spasms, and hysteria, is widely believed to have triggered outbreaks of 'madness' that locals attributed to demonic possession—most famously during the Salem Witch Trials. The tragic result was a centuries-long campaign of persecution, where thousands of individuals, mostly women with traditional botanical knowledge, were hunted, put on trial, and executed. This fascinating history reveals how a single class of natural substances could be viewed as a bridge to the divine in one era, and a ticket to the gallows in the next.
